Personal religion in domestic contexts during the New Kingdom : the impact of the Amarna period /

This study has three main themes: the definition of personal religion and religious domestic practices from a theoretical perspective; the description and analysis of the main archaeological and anthropological evidence; and, on that basis, the study of the impact of the Amarna period in the develop...
